BRAWLEY v. BRAWLEY

No. 8721SC25.

361 S.E.2d 759 (1987)

James O. BRAWLEY, Jr. v. Wilda T. BRAWLEY, Cedar Crest, Inc., and Condominium Builders, Inc.

Court of Appeals of North Carolina.

November 17, 1987.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Bell, Davis & Pitt, P.A., by Walter W. Pitt, Jr. and Stephen M. Russell, Winston-Salem, for defendant-appellant.

Womble Carlyle Sandridge & Rice by Michael E. Ray and Thomas L. Nesbit, Winston-Salem, for defendants-appellees.


JOHNSON, Judge.

Defendant's appeal presents three questions for review; whether the trial court erred in granting defendant CBI's (hereinafter known as appellee) motion for summary judgment on its crossclaim and counterclaim for specific performance of the contract; whether the trial court erred in denying defendant Wilda Brawley's (hereinafter known as appellant) motion to dismiss for failure to state a claim and alternative motion for summary judgment; and whether...
